Examples of PolySubClassThree


Examples of org.apache.isis.runtimes.dflt.objectstores.sql.testsystem.dataclasses.polymorphism.PolySubClassThree

        final PolySubClassTwo polySubClassTwo = factory.newPolySubClassTwo();
        polySubClassTwo.setStringBase("PolySubClassTwo 1");
        polySubClassTwo.setStringClassTwo("Class 2");

        final PolySubClassThree polySubClassThree = factory.newPolySubClassThree();
        polySubClassThree.setStringBase("PolySubClassThree 1");
        polySubClassThree.setStringClassThree("Another String");
        polySubClassThree.setStringClassTwo("Class 3");

        polyTestClass.getPolyBaseClasses().add(polySubClassOne);
        polyTestClass.getPolyBaseClasses().add(polySubClassTwo);
        polyTestClass.getPolyBaseClasses().add(polySubClassThree);
View Full Code Here

Examples of org.apache.isis.runtimes.dflt.objectstores.sql.testsystem.dataclasses.polymorphism.PolySubClassThree

        final PolySubClassTwo polySubClassTwo = (PolySubClassTwo) polyClassBase;
        assertEquals("Class 2", polySubClassTwo.getStringClassTwo());

        polyClassBase = polyBaseClasses.get(2);
        assertTrue(polyClassBase instanceof PolySubClassThree);
        final PolySubClassThree polySubClassThree = (PolySubClassThree) polyClassBase;
        assertEquals("Class 3", polySubClassThree.getStringClassTwo());
        assertEquals("Another String", polySubClassThree.getStringClassThree());
    }
View Full Code Here

Examples of org.apache.isis.runtimes.dflt.objectstores.sql.testsystem.dataclasses.polymorphism.PolySubClassThree

        final PolySubClassOne object = newTransientInstance(PolySubClassOne.class);
        return object;
    }

    public PolySubClassThree newPolySubClassThree() {
        final PolySubClassThree object = newTransientInstance(PolySubClassThree.class);
        return object;
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.